The control arm locates the wheel and works with the vehicle's suspension to hold proper alignment while isolating road input; the integrated ball joint lets the knuckle pivot as the suspension travels and the wheel steers.

Signs this part may need replacing include clunking on acceleration, deceleration, or over bumps, uneven or excessive tire wear, loose or wandering steering, or a worn/torn ball-joint boot. Diagnose the cause before replacing, and replace worn suspension components as directed by the service procedure.
